What companies run services between Tampa, FL, USA and Machupicchu Guest House, Machu Picchu, Peru?

There is no direct connection from Tampa to Machupicchu Guest House, Machu Picchu. However, you can take the bus to Airport Rental Car Center, walk to SkyConnect Rental Car Center Station, take the vehicle to SkyConnect Passenger Terminal Station, walk to Tampa (TPA) airport, fly to Alejandro Velasco Astete International Airport (CUZ), walk to Cusco Airport, take the bus to Avenida Pardo, walk to Cusco - Wanchaq, take the train to Machu Picchu Pueblo, then walk to Machupicchu Guest House, Machu Picchu. Alternatively, you can take the train to Kissimmee Amtrak Station, take the train to Sand Lake Road, walk to Office Ct & Sand Lake Sunrail, take the line 42 bus to Orlando International Airport, walk to Orlando (MCO) airport, fly to Alejandro Velasco Astete International Airport (CUZ), walk to Cusco Airport, take the bus to Avenida Pardo, walk to Cusco - Wanchaq, take the train to Machu Picchu Pueblo, then walk to Machupicchu Guest House, Machu Picchu.
